No. 17 Tulane Upends State Rival UL-Lafayette
Apr 10, 2005 | Men's Tennis
April 10, 2005
NEW ORLEANS, La. - Tulane University had its Senior Day ceremony for men's tennis on Sunday afternoon and the lone senior on the team, Dmitriy Koch, gave the fans a near-perfect performance in the final home match of his career at the Goldring Tennis Center. Koch posted a 6-0, 6-0 victory at No. 1 singles to lead the Green Wave to a 4-0 victory over No. 42 UL-Lafayette.
Tulane (18-4) struggled in doubles to open the match, but then rallied to earn the point. The Ragin' Cajuns won at No. 1 doubles and led at both No. 2 and No. 3. However, Jacobo Hernandez and Ted Angelinos battled back for an 8-6 win at No. 2, leaving the point in the hands of David Goulet and Jonah Kane-West at No. 3. After fending off multiple match points, the Green Wave duo won the tiebreaker, 7-4, to clinch the 9-8 victory and the doubles point.
Koch quickly dispatched his foe at No. 1 singles for a 2-0 Wave advantage and then Alberto Sottocorno posted a 6-3, 6-2 triumph at No. 5 singles. Goulet clinched the victory with a 6-4, 6-4 victory at No. 3 singles.
Tulane has now won 12 of its last 13 matches to climb to No. 17 in the national rankings. The Green Wave will close the regular season on the road at No. 16 LSU on Wednesday at 4 p.m. The Conference USA Tournament begins April 21 in Louisville, Ky., as Tulane will look for its fifth championship under head coach Robert Klein. The winner of the C-USA Tournament receives an automatic bid to the NCAA Tournament; the Wave has advanced to the NCAAs eight straight years.

No. 17 Tulane 4, No. 42 UL-Lafayette 0
Doubles:
1. Corduneanu/Singh (ULL) def. Koch/ Sottocorno (TU): 8-5
2. Angelinos/Hernandez (TU) def. Tabak/Abakar (ULL): 8-6
3. Goulet/Kane-West (TU) def. Ley/Ellison (ULL): 9-8
Singles:
1. Dmitriy Koch (TU) def. Evghenii Corduneanu (ULL): 6-0, 6-0
2. Ted Angelinos (TU) v. #92 Dusan Tabak (ULL): 6-7, 5-2, Did not finish
3. David Goulet (TU) def. Amanjot Singh (ULL): 6-4, 6-4
4. Jacobo Hernandez (TU) v. Robin Ley (ULL): 6-2, 1-6, Did not finish
5. Alberto Sottocorno (TU) def. Shaun Ellison (ULL): 6-3, 6-2
6. Jonah Kane-West (TU) v. Kerei Abakar (ULL): 7-5, 5-6, Did not finish
